Strange Flavor Eggplant
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Ready In: 50 Minutes
Servings: 8
Great party dip
Ingredients:
1 eggplant (approx 1 pound)
1 tablespoon minced ginger
1 tablespoon minced garlic clove
1/4 cup scallion, sliced
1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
3 tablespoons soy sauce
3 tablespoons brown sugar
1 teaspoon rice vinegar
1 tablespoon hot water
1 tablespoon canola oil
1/2 teaspoon sesame oil
handful cilantro (to garnish)
Directions:
1. Pierce eggplant with fork in several places. Bake at 475 until tender and somewhat collapsed (20-40 minutes).
2. Remove from oven and slash down the center. When cool enough to handle, remove flesh from skin and puree in food processor or blender.
3. In large frying pan, briefly saute ginger, garlic, scallions, and red pepper in canola oil.
4. Mix together soy sauce, brown sugar, rice vinegar, and hot water to make sauce.
5. Add sauce to ingredients in frying pan and bring to a gentle simmer.
6. Add eggplant, mix together, and heat through.
7. Remove from heat, add sesame oil, and mix thoroughly.
8. Garnish with cilantro and serve with pita chips or crostini.
